How To Insert Header In Power Point? (Question)

How to Insert Headers and Footers in PowerPoint. To insert headers and footers in PowerPoint, open your presentation, and then click “Insert.” In the “Text” group, click “Header and Footer.” When the window opens, you’ll be in the “Slide” tab.

How do you add a header to a PowerPoint?

  • Open the presentation where you want to add a Header or Footer. Access the Insert tab of the Ribbon, as shown in Figure 3 (highlighted in blue). Within the Insert tab, click the Header Footer button (highlighted in red within Figure 4). Tip: You can also click either the Date Time or Slide Number buttons.

Does PowerPoint have a Header?

PowerPoint allows you to create headers and footers, that is, information that appears at the top and bottom of all slides. First, you need to access the INSERT tab and click on the Header & Footer button. A dialog box will appear, as shown in the screenshot below.

How do I change the Header in PowerPoint?

Click INSERT > Header & Footer. Click the Slide tab, make the changes you want, and click either Apply to apply the changes to the selected slides, or Apply to All to make the changes to all the slides.

How do you add a Header in PowerPoint online?

In PowerPoint Online, click Edit Presentation, and then Edit in PowerPoint. On the Insert tab, click Header & Footer. After entering the information into the footer, save it to OneDrive, and then open it in PowerPoint Online.

How do I insert Header and Footer in notes and handouts in PowerPoint?

Add page numbers, footers, headers, or date to Notes pages On the Insert tab of the toolbar ribbon, select Header & Footer. The Header and Footer dialog box appears. In the Header and Footer dialog box, select the Notes and Handouts tab.

How do I insert a picture into a header in PowerPoint?

To add an image:

  1. Open the Handout Master tab, click the Insert menu, and then click Picture > Picture from File.
  2. Browse to the image you want and click Insert.
  3. Drag the image to the location you want and resize it if necessary. For additional formatting options, click the Picture Format tab.

How do you add a header and footer in PowerPoint 2007?

Let’s review the steps:

  1. First, open the presentation and click on the Insert tab.
  2. In the ribbon, go to the text grouping of commands and click on Headers & Footers.
  3. The Header and Footer dialogue box will open.
  4. You’ll want to click on the Notes and Handouts tab.
  5. You’ll make your selections and click on Apply to All.

How do you put a header on all slides in PowerPoint?

You can also add things like the date and time, and slide numbers.

  1. Click INSERT > Header & Footer.
  2. On the Slide tab, check Footer.
  3. In the box below Footer, type the text that you want, such as the presentation title.
  4. Check Date and time to add that to your slides.
  5. Check Slide number to add that to your slides.

What is footer and header?

A header is text that is placed at the top of a page, while a footer is placed at the bottom, or foot, of a page. Typically these areas are used for inserting document information, such as the name of the document, the chapter heading, page numbers, creation date and the like.

How do I insert a logo into PowerPoint?

Try it!

  1. To add a logo to all the slides, Select View > Slide Master.
  2. Select Insert > Shapes, pick a shape and then click and drag to draw the text box on the slide master.
  3. Right-click on the shape > Format Shape to open the menu.
  4. Under the bucket icon, select Fill > Picture fill > File and insert your logo image.

Where do you put your name on a PowerPoint presentation?

You can name or rename a slide by using a slide layout that has a title placeholder.

  1. Select the slide whose layout you will change so that it can have a title.
  2. Click Home > Layout.
  3. Select Title Slide for a standalone title page or select Title and Content for a slide that contains a title and a full slide text box.

Where do slide headers appear if used?

Headers and footers appear at the top and bottom of your slides and are there to display additional information. After you insert a header or a footer, you can always edit and add more data to it.

How do you insert watermark in PowerPoint?

In PowerPoint, you can put a text background in your slides to get that watermark effect.

  1. To add a watermark to all the slides, Select View > Slide Master.
  2. Select Insert > Text Box, and then click and drag to draw the text box on the slide master.
  3. Type the watermark text (such as “DRAFT”) in the text box.

How do you add a header and Footer in PowerPoint 2010?

Adding Header & Footer in Powerpoint 2010

  1. Step 1 − In the Insert ribbon, click on the Header & Footer menu item.
  2. Step 2 − The Header and Footer dialog has two tabs — the Slide tab and the Notes and Handouts tab.
  3. Step 3 − You can add details to the slide footer from the Slide tab.
